Job Summary

**Open only to current permanent employees of the Oklahoma City VA Health Care system** The Float Pool Registered Nurse (RN) is responsible for providing competent, evidence-based care to assigned patients and oversight of licensed vocational nurses/nursing assistants, as appropriate to the setting. The nurse will assist in directing the provision of nursing education, orientation, competencies and providing quality improvement and outcomes utilization consultation.

Key Responsibilities

To maintain status as 'active' intermittent nursing staff requirements are: Must work a minimum of three shifts per month to include one weekend shift where there is a need in the facility, which may include off tour hours; except as approved by supervisor for extenuating circumstances. Intermittent personnel will be required to work on major summer holiday (Memorial Day, July 4 or Labor Day) and one major winter holiday (Thanksgiving, Christmas, or New Year's Day).

Off tours include evenings, nights, and all hours on weekends and holidays. Absenteeism/cancellation of two (2) or more scheduled tours within eight (8) weeks may result in corrective action. Intermittent RN Nursing staff may serve as charge nurse after completing initial orientation and charge nurse orientation.

Per VA Handbook 5005/57, Part II, Chapter 3, an intermittent employee may not be scheduled for employment which will exceed 1820 hours or seven-eighths of full-time employment during a service year. Per VA Handbook 5007/42.

Part Ill, Chapter 5, periodic step increases for an intermittent employee: The waiting period requirements for intermittent nursing employees is 260 days of credible service in a pay status over a period of not less than 52 calendar weeks, where by 1 day of credit is given for each day of service in a pay status.

Duties include, but are not limited to: Provides competent, evidence-based care to assigned patients and oversight of licensed vocational nurses/nursing assistants, as appropriate to the setting. Provides direct and indirect nursing care to patients in multiple care units. Integrates knowledge, skills, abilities, and judgment and is self-directed in goal setting for managing complex situations for varying areas of nursing.

Demonstrates the ability to cope with and manage competing priorities. Demonstrates competence in practice and decision-making, deliberate planning, and critical thinking skills for all patient care areas included within Resource Pool/Float assignments. Fosters a safe and supportive environment conducive to the professional development of healthcare professionals. Contributes professional nursing perspective in discussions with the interdisciplinary team.

Partners with others to effect change and produce optimal outcomes. Supports colleagues through knowledge sharing to provide safe, quality nursing care. Participates in activities and strategies to sustain evidence-based-practice. Identifies care needs between assigned units and reports findings within Shared Governance Structure and management.

VA offers a comprehensive total rewards package: VA Nurse Total Rewards Pay: Competitive salary, regular salary increases, potential for performance awards Paid Time Off: 50 days of paid time off per year (26 days of annual leave, 13 days of sick leave, 11 paid Federal holidays per year) Retirement: Traditional federal pension (5 years vesting) and federal 401K with up to 5% in contributions by VA Insurance: Federal health/vision/dental/term life/long-term care (many federal insurance programs can be carried into retirement) Licensure: 1 full and unrestricted license from any US State or territory Work Schedule: 1530 - 2400 (Three 8-hour shifts per month, after 8 hours it is considered overtime.) Compressed/Flexible: Not Available - Intermittent/As Needed Telework: Not Available Virtual: This is not a virtual position.

Requirements & Education

IMPORTANT: A transcript must be submitted with your application if you are basing all or part of your qualifications on education. Note: Only education or degrees recognized by the U.S. Department of Education from accredited colleges, universities, schools, or institutions may be used to qualify for Federal employment. You can verify your education here: http://ope.ed.gov/accreditation/.

If you are using foreign education to meet qualification requirements, you must send a Certificate of Foreign Equivalency with your transcript to receive credit for that education.
